    Dinner at Fire & Ice was a highlight of our month-long sojourn in New England. Housed in an old…read morefarmhouse just outside of Middlebury, Fire & Ice features locally sourced fresh and natural ingredients in an ambitious menu that will satisfy most palates. The restaurant has been around for more than half a century and has an eclectic decor with walls covered in black and white photos, hundred year old Hackercraft motorboat, biplane propellers, and wooden skis that likely were used to carve up Stowe and Killington. We started with a watermelon margarita and an extra dry Hendricks Gibson up. The drinks were perfectly chilled and hit the spot after a long day touring Fort Ticonderoga. We were told that their prime rib was the belle of the Fire & Ice ball so we made that our dinner. Roasted slowly overnight, the meat is perfectly medium rare inside with a delectable crust. Served with a range of sides and a generous dollop of freshly grated horseradish, we could not have been more pleased with the quality and quantity of the prime rib. They have an interesting dessert cart but, after 40 ounces of delicious prime rib, we gave the sweet course a miss. Fire & Ice is a compelling option for those spending time in Middlebury. We highly recommend this venue.
